/*
* GTK UI -- clipboard support
*
* Copyright (C) 2021 Gerd Hoffmann <kraxel@redhat.com>
*
* This program is free software; you can redistribute it and/or modify
* it under the terms of the GNU General Public License as published by
* the Free Software Foundation; either version 2 of the License, or
* (at your option) any later version.
*
* This program is distributed in the hope that it will be useful,
* but WITHOUT ANY WARRANTY; without even the implied warranty of
* M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E. See the GNU
* General Public License for more details.
*
* You should have received a copy of the GNU General Public License
* along with this program; if not, see <http://www.gnu.org/licenses/>.
*
*/
#include "qemu/osdep.h"
#include "qemu/main-loop.h"
#include "ui/gtk.h"
static QemuClipboardSelection gd_find_selection(GtkDisplayState *gd,
GtkClipboard *clipboard)
{
QemuClipboardSelection s;
for (s = 0; s < QEMU_CLIPBOARD_SELECTION__COUNT; s++) {
if (gd->gtkcb[s] == clipboard) {
return s;
}
}
return QEMU_CLIPBOARD_SELECTION_CLIPBOARD;
}
static void gd_clipboard_get_data(GtkClipboard *clipboard,
GtkSelectionData *selection_data,
guint selection_info,
gpointer data)
{
GtkDisplayState *gd = data;
QemuClipboardSelection s = gd_find_selection(gd, clipboard);
QemuClipboardType type = QEMU_CLIPBOARD_TYPE_TEXT;
g_autoptr(QemuClipboardInfo) info = NULL;
info = qemu_clipboard_info_ref(qemu_clipboard_info(s));
qemu_clipboard_request(info, type);
while (info == qemu_clipboard_info(s) &&
info->types[type].available &&
info->types[type].data == NULL) {
main_loop_wait(false);
}
if (info == qemu_clipboard_info(s) && gd->cbowner[s]) {
gtk_selection_data_set_text(selection_data,
info->types[type].data,
info->types[type].size);
} else {
/* clipboard owner changed while waiting for the data */
}
}
static void gd_clipboard_clear(GtkClipboard *clipboard,
gpointer data)
{
GtkDisplayState *gd = data;
QemuClipboardSelection s = gd_find_selection(gd, clipboard);
gd->cbowner[s] = false;
}
static void gd_clipboard_update_info(GtkDisplayState *gd,
QemuClipboardInfo *info)
{
QemuClipboardSelection s = info->selection;
bool self_update = info->owner == &gd->cbpeer;
if (info != qemu_clipboard_info(s)) {
gd->cbpending[s] = 0;
if (!self_update) {
g_autoptr(GtkTargetList) list = NULL;
GtkTargetEntry *targets;
gint n_targets;
list = gtk_target_list_new(NULL, 0);
if (info->types[QEMU_CLIPBOARD_TYPE_TEXT].available) {
gtk_target_list_add_text_targets(list, 0);
}
targets = gtk_target_table_new_from_list(list, &n_targets);
gtk_clipboard_clear(gd->gtkcb[s]);
if (targets) {
gd->cbowner[s] = true;
gtk_clipboard_set_with_data(gd->gtkcb[s],
targets, n_targets,
gd_clipboard_get_data,
gd_clipboard_clear,
gd);
gtk_target_table_free(targets, n_targets);
}
}
return;
}
if (self_update) {
return;
}
/*
* Clipboard got updated, with data probably. No action here, we
* are waiting for updates in gd_clipboard_get_data().
*/
}
static void gd_clipboard_notify(Notifier *notifier, void *data)
{
GtkDisplayState *gd =
container_of(notifier, GtkDisplayState, cbpeer.notifier);
QemuClipboardNotify *notify = data;
switch (notify->type) {
case QEMU_CLIPBOARD_UPDATE_INFO:
gd_clipboard_update_info(gd, notify->info);
return;
case QEMU_CLIPBOARD_RESET_SERIAL:
/* ignore */
return;
}
}
static void gd_clipboard_request(QemuClipboardInfo *info,
QemuClipboardType type)
{
GtkDisplayState *gd = container_of(info->owner, GtkDisplayState, cbpeer);
char *text;
switch (type) {
case QEMU_CLIPBOARD_TYPE_TEXT:
text = gtk_clipboard_wait_for_text(gd->gtkcb[info->selection]);
if (text) {
qemu_clipboard_set_data(&gd->cbpeer, info, type,
strlen(text), text, true);
g_free(text);
}
break;
default:
break;
}
}
static void gd_owner_change(GtkClipboard *clipboard,
GdkEvent *event,
gpointer data)
{
GtkDisplayState *gd = data;
QemuClipboardSelection s = gd_find_selection(gd, clipboard);
QemuClipboardInfo *info;
if (gd->cbowner[s]) {
/* ignore notifications about our own grabs */
return;
}
switch (event->owner_change.reason) {
case GDK_OWNER_CHANGE_NEW_OWNER:
info = qemu_clipboard_info_new(&gd->cbpeer, s);
if (gtk_clipboard_wait_is_text_available(clipboard)) {
info->types[QEMU_CLIPBOARD_TYPE_TEXT].available = true;
}
qemu_clipboard_update(info);
qemu_clipboard_info_unref(info);
break;
default:
qemu_clipboard_peer_release(&gd->cbpeer, s);
gd->cbowner[s] = false;
break;
}
}
void gd_clipboard_init(GtkDisplayState *gd)
{
gd->cbpeer.name = "gtk";
gd->cbpeer.notifier.notify = gd_clipboard_notify;
gd->cbpeer.request = gd_clipboard_request;
qemu_clipboard_peer_register(&gd->cbpeer);
gd->gtkcb[QEMU_CLIPBOARD_SELECTION_CLIPBOARD] =
gtk_clipboard_get(GDK_SELECTION_CLIPBOARD);
gd->gtkcb[QEMU_CLIPBOARD_SELECTION_PRIMARY] =
gtk_clipboard_get(GDK_SELECTION_PRIMARY);
gd->gtkcb[QEMU_CLIPBOARD_SELECTION_SECONDARY] =
gtk_clipboard_get(GDK_SELECTION_SECONDARY);
g_signal_connect(gd->gtkcb[QEMU_CLIPBOARD_SELECTION_CLIPBOARD],
"owner-change", G_CALLBACK(gd_owner_change), gd);
g_signal_connect(gd->gtkcb[QEMU_CLIPBOARD_SELECTION_PRIMARY],
"owner-change", G_CALLBACK(gd_owner_change), gd);
g_signal_connect(gd->gtkcb[QEMU_CLIPBOARD_SELECTION_SECONDARY],
"owner-change", G_CALLBACK(gd_owner_change), gd);
}
